Understanding Fascia and SoffitWhat is Fascia?
Fascia refers to the horizontal board that runs along the roofing's edge. It is usually the noticeable trim utilized to connect the roofline to the home's outside walls. The fascia board plays an important function in supporting the lower edge of the roofing system, attaching the rain gutters, and often adding a completing touch to the architectural design of the house.
What is Soffit?
Soffit is the material that covers the underside of overhanging eaves. It fills the gap in between the roofline and the exterior wall, supplying total protection while enhancing the overall look of the eaves. Soffits are important for ventilation, as they enable air to stream into the attic space, assisting to maintain proper temperature level balance and prevent wetness buildup.
Why Upgrade Fascia and Soffit?
Updating fascia and soffit components can yield a host of benefits, consisting of:
Aesthetic Appeal: New fascia and soffit products can complement the design of your home, elevating its curb appeal.Defense from Moisture: Poorly kept fascia and soffit can rot or end up being plagued with bugs. Updating fascia and soffit requires an in-depth method to make sure sturdiness and correct function. Here's a quick overview of the installation process:

Assessment: Evaluate the existing condition of your fascia and soffit. Try to find indications of rot, damage, or pests.

Material Selection: Choose the appropriate products based on aesthetics, maintenance choices, and budget.

Preparation: Remove the old fascia and soffit products carefully. Make sure all locations are clean and without particles.

Installation:
Install the brand-new soffit panels, ensuring correct ventilation.Connect the fascia boards, securing them tightly and looking for any spaces where moisture might enter.
Ending up Touches: Paint or seal the new materials as required and install rain gutters, guaranteeing they are securely attached to the fascia.
Often Asked Questions (FAQs)1. What is the perfect time for fascia and soffit upgrades?
The perfect time for these upgrades is normally throughout spring or early fall when climate condition are moderate. Preventing severe temperature levels can assist guarantee the products set effectively and maintain their shape.
2. How do I know if my fascia and soffit requirement to be changed?
Indications of damage include peeling paint, sagging boards, water damage, or visible spaces. If you can see rot or bug problems, it's time to think about an upgrade.
3. Can I set up fascia and soffit upgrades myself?
While some homeowners might feel positive in DIY setups, working with experts is typically recommended. They bring expertise and guarantee that the installation fulfills local building regulations.
4. What should I try to find in a contractor?
When selecting a contractor, look for licenses and insurance coverage, request referrals, and check out reviews. It's useful to get multiple quotes to guarantee you get a reasonable cost.
5. How much does it generally cost to upgrade fascia and soffit?
The cost can differ substantially based upon elements such as product choice, labor expenses, and the general size of your home. Typically, homeowners may invest in between ₤ 1,500 and ₤ 5,000.
